Output 63dc4c1eb32a9aa7dfc8f863c78c84ab9045c22f37e6dff37e9df6a83da3ee9d:0

value
1000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f376c35ebfc28350c2244656c0e71df11b67d1 OP_EQUAL
address
3BMEXraQHdNjtd7QrVSuAd36tHQuWeZZCw
transaction
63dc4c1eb32a9aa7dfc8f863c78c84ab9045c22f37e6dff37e9df6a83da3ee9d
spent
true